Regular Septic Tank Pumping Prevents Excess Waste Accumulation

Solids naturally settle inside a septic tank over time, creating a sludge layer that gradually grows thicker with everyday use. Without routine septic tank pumping, that buildup can reduce available tank capacity and increase the risk of waste entering the drain field, where much more expensive problems can begin.


Professional septic tank pumping services remove accumulated solids before they reach harmful levels. Many homeowners delay service because the system appears to be working normally, but healthy septic systems often show few warning signs until significant issues develop. Water Usage Habits Directly Affect System Performance

Large amounts of water entering the system within a short period can overwhelm a septic tank’s ability to separate solids from wastewater. Multiple laundry loads, long showers, and heavy household water use may place unnecessary strain on the system.


Thoughtful water management helps maintain proper treatment inside the tank. Spacing out water-intensive activities allows wastewater to move through the system more effectively. Drain Field Protection Supports Long-Term Reliability

The drain field performs an essential role in wastewater treatment after liquids leave the septic tank. Compacted soil, vehicle traffic, and construction activity can damage this area and limit its ability to absorb and filter wastewater properly.

Healthy drain fields require protection from unnecessary weight and disturbance. Parking vehicles, storing heavy equipment, or building structures above the drain field can create problems that are difficult and expensive to correct. Household Products Can Influence Septic System Health

Everyday products eventually make their way into the septic system. Certain cleaning chemicals, solvents, grease, and non-biodegradable materials may interfere with natural bacterial activity inside the tank.

Beneficial bacteria help break down waste and support efficient system operation. Excessive use of harsh chemicals can disrupt that balance and reduce treatment effectiveness. Routine Inspections Help Identify Problems Early

Many septic issues begin quietly and remain hidden underground long before visible symptoms appear. Small concerns such as damaged baffles, rising sludge levels, or minor drain field problems can often be addressed more affordably when discovered early. Scheduled inspections provide valuable information about system condition and maintenance needs. Rather than waiting for sewage backups or drainage problems, homeowners can use inspections to monitor performance and plan future service. Landscaping Choices Can Affect Underground Components

Trees and shrubs add beauty to a property, but certain plantings can create challenges for septic systems. Root systems naturally seek moisture and may eventually reach pipes, tanks, or drain field components. Careful landscaping helps reduce the risk of underground intrusion. Property owners should understand the location of septic components before planting large trees or aggressive root-producing vegetation nearby. Warning Signs Deserve Immediate Attention

Healthy septic systems generally operate without drawing attention to themselves. Changes in performance often indicate developing problems that should not be ignored. Slow drains, sewage odors, unusually green grass near the drain field, gurgling plumbing fixtures, or standing water around septic components may signal underlying concerns. Prompt evaluation helps prevent minor issues from becoming major repairs requiring extensive excavation or system replacement.

Pumping Schedules Should Match Household Needs

No single pumping schedule works for every property. Household size, water usage habits, tank capacity, and daily wastewater volume all influence how quickly solids accumulate inside the tank.

Larger families typically generate more wastewater than smaller households. A home occupied by six people may require more frequent service than a similar property occupied by two. Record Keeping Helps Simplify Future Maintenance

Many homeowners struggle to remember when their last septic tank service occurred. Missing maintenance records can make it difficult to establish proper service intervals and identify developing trends over time.

Maintaining a simple record of inspections, pumping visits, repairs, and system modifications provides valuable long-term information. Accurate documentation allows future service providers to make better recommendations and helps homeowners stay ahead of maintenance needs.
